Title :
Cost Savings at the Expense of Quality, Safety, and the Environment. A Plastic Molding Example

Abstract :
This paper uses plastic molded bobbins, headers and toroid mounts used in the electronics industry to highlight quality, safety and environmental trade-offs being made in favor of lower component costs. The trade-offs are often made without understanding the cost and risks being transferred from purchasing to more costly portions of the product manufacturing process, or to the customer.
